Understanding Infrastructure Innovations
Infrastructure Innovations refer to advanced technologies and methodologies that improve the design, implementation, and management of IT infrastructure. These include advancements in cloud computing, virtualization, networking, and storage solutions, among others.
Key Strategies for Leveraging Infrastructure Innovations
1. Embrace Cloud Computing
a. Adopt Cloud Services Leverage cloud computing services such as Infrastructure as a Service (IaaS), Platform as a Service (PaaS), and Software as a Service (SaaS) to gain scalability, flexibility, and cost efficiency. Cloud solutions can reduce the need for on-premises hardware and provide access to advanced tools and applications.
b. Implement Multi-Cloud and Hybrid Cloud Strategies Consider a multi-cloud approach to avoid vendor lock-in and enhance resilience by using services from multiple cloud providers. A hybrid cloud strategy allows you to integrate on-premises infrastructure with cloud services, providing greater flexibility and control.
c. Utilize Cloud Management Tools Deploy cloud management platforms to oversee and optimize cloud resource usage, manage costs, and ensure compliance. These tools provide visibility into cloud environments and help streamline operations.
2. Leverage Virtualization Technologies
a. Virtualize Servers and Desktops Implement server virtualization to consolidate physical servers, reduce hardware costs, and enhance resource utilization. Virtual desktop infrastructure (VDI) enables remote access to desktop environments, improving flexibility and security.
b. Use Containerization Adopt containerization technologies such as Docker and Kubernetes to package and deploy applications consistently across different environments. Containers provide portability, scalability, and efficient resource utilization.
c. Implement Network Function Virtualization (NFV) Utilize NFV to virtualize network services traditionally provided by hardware appliances. NFV enables faster deployment, scalability, and reduced costs for network management.
3. Enhance Networking Capabilities
a. Adopt Software-Defined Networking (SDN) Implement SDN to gain greater control over network traffic and configurations through centralized management. SDN simplifies network management, improves agility, and enables automated network provisioning.
b. Utilize Network Automation Deploy network automation tools to streamline configuration, monitoring, and management tasks. Automation reduces manual intervention, minimizes errors, and enhances network performance.
c. Implement 5G Technology Explore the benefits of 5G technology for improved network speed, reduced latency, and enhanced connectivity. 5G can support advanced applications and provide faster data transmission for critical IT operations.
4. Optimize Storage Solutions
a. Implement Software-Defined Storage (SDS) Use SDS to abstract and manage storage resources through software, providing flexibility and scalability. SDS can improve storage efficiency and reduce costs by enabling dynamic allocation of storage resources.
b. Leverage Flash Storage Adopt flash storage solutions to achieve higher performance and faster data access compared to traditional hard drives. Flash storage enhances application performance and reduces latency.
c. Utilize Storage Area Networks (SANs) Deploy SANs to centralize storage resources and improve data access speed. SANs provide high-speed connectivity and scalability, supporting demanding workloads and large-scale data operations.
5. Focus on Security and Compliance
a. Implement Advanced Security Solutions Adopt cutting-edge security technologies, such as next-generation firewalls, intrusion detection systems, and threat intelligence platforms. These solutions help protect IT infrastructure from evolving threats and vulnerabilities.
b. Ensure Compliance Stay informed about relevant regulations and standards, such as GDPR, HIPAA, and PCI-DSS. Implement infrastructure solutions that support compliance requirements and maintain data protection and privacy.
c. Conduct Regular Security Audits Perform regular security audits and vulnerability assessments to identify and address potential risks. Continuous monitoring and assessment help ensure that your infrastructure remains secure and compliant.
